核心是这样
for (int i = 0; i < m; i++)
{
if (dp[x[i]] > 0)
{
ans += dp[x[i]];
}
for (int j = max_sum; j >= x[i]; j--)
{
dp[j] += dp[j - x[i]];
}
}
核心是这样
for (int i = 0; i < m; i++)
{
if (dp[x[i]] > 0)
{
ans += dp[x[i]];
}
for (int j = max_sum; j >= x[i]; j--)
{
dp[j] += dp[j - x[i]];
}
}
嗯??
尊渡假赌
A……A……A……A……A……A……AC了!!
求解决方案
给了
再见ヾ(•ω•`)o
@ 栗子酱,可以关了